■ Logical Delink and
Reconfiguration of Hard Disk
(Remove Link)
Logical delinking of hard disk (Remove Link) is a situation
where a hard disk is not physically removed but a hard disk
is not recognized. You may want to use delinking in the sit-
uation that a hard disk in this unit or an add-on unit fails
(hard disk marked with "*", "LOST" or "ERROR"), and you
would like to disconnect the hard disk temporarily and keep
on operating.
You can activate the delinking function by following the pro-
cedure below.
z Turn on this unit and press the [SET] button after com-
pletion of system check.
Note: If the hard disk is taken out, the top page of the
disk configuration menu automatically appears.
[Screenshot 1]
The top page of the disk configuration menu appears.
x Press the arrows button (A and B) to move the cursor
to "Remove Link" and press the [SET] button.
[Screenshot 2]
A message to confirm delinking appears.
c Move the cursor to "OK" and press the [SET] button.
→ The remove link function is executed and the check
screen appears.
[Screenshot 3]
The remove link function is executed and the check screen
appears.
v The top page of the disk configuration menu automati-
cally resumes after completion of remove link.
